Key Ingredients & Substitutions

Ground Beef: I like using lean ground beef for this recipe, but you can easily swap it out for turkey or chicken for a lighter option. For a vegetarian version, try using a plant-based ground meat alternative!

Bacon: Bacon adds a great smoky flavor. If you want to reduce fat, turkey bacon works well too. For a meat-free option, consider using crumbled tempeh or mushrooms to replicate the texture.

Cheeses: Cheddar and mozzarella are classic choices here. If you’re looking for something different, feel free to use pepper jack for a kick or a combination of your favorite cheeses. Cream cheese can also be added to the ricotta mixture for extra creaminess.

Heavy Cream: If you’re looking for a lower-calorie alternative, try using half-and-half or a plant-based cream. For dairy-free options, coconut cream works nicely, but keep in mind it may add a slight coconut flavor.

What’s the Secret to Layering Lasagna Perfectly?

Layering is essential for a great lasagna. Start with a thin base of the ricotta mix to prevent sticking, then alternate layers of noodles, meat, and cheese.

  • Use three noodles per layer to keep it even.
  • Press down lightly as you go to help everything stick together.
  • Top with cheese to create a gooey, golden crust, making sure to cover the noodles completely for even cooking.

Don’t rush! Let it rest after baking; this helps it hold its shape better when serving.

Ingredients You’ll Need:

Lasagna Components:

  • 9 lasagna noodles, cooked according to package instructions
  • 1 lb ground beef
  • 6 slices bacon, ch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ced

Cheese Mixture:

  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 ½ cups sh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1 ½ cups ricotta cheese
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ese

Other Ingredients:

  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on dried Italian seasoning
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

How Much Time Will You Need?

This delicious dish takes about 40 minutes to prepare and cook, plus an additional 10 minutes for resting. So, about 50 minutes from start to finish for a savory and comforting meal!

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Preheat and Prepare:

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). While that’s heating up, lightly grease a 9×13 inch baking dish to prevent sticking later.

2. Cook the Bacon:

In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the chopped bacon until it’s crispy and delicious. Once done, remove the bacon using a slotted spoon and place it on paper towels to drain the grease.

3. Sauté Garlic:

With some of the bacon fat still in the skillet, add the olive oil and sauté the minced garlic for about 1 minute, until it’s fragrant. This adds a wonderful flavor base!

4. Cook the Beef:

Add the ground beef to the skillet and cook until it’s browned and no longer pink, breaking it up with a spoon as you go. Drain any excess fat if needed.

5. Mix in Seasonings:

Stir in the crispy bacon pieces, Italian seasoning, salt, and black pepper. Remove from the heat to let the flavors meld.

6. Make the Cheese Mixture:

In a medium bowl, mix together the ricotta cheese, Parmesan cheese, and heavy cream. Stir until the mixture is smooth and creamy. This will be your delicious cheese layer!

7. Assemble Your Lasagna:

Spread a thin layer of the ricotta mixture on the bottom of the greased baking dish. Next, layer 3 cooked lasagna noodles over the ricotta.

8. Layer the Filling:

Spread about one-third of the beef and bacon mixture over the noodles, followed by one-third of the shredded cheddar and mozzarella cheeses. Repeat this layering process twice more, ending with a final sprinkle of cheddar and mozzarella cheese on top.

9. Bake the Lasagna:

Cover the lasagna with aluminum foil and bake it for 25 minutes. After that, remove the foil and bake uncovered for an additional 15 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.

10. Let it Rest:

Once done, remove the lasagna from the oven and let it rest for 10 minutes. This helps everything set up nicely, making it easier to slice.

11. Serve and Enjoy:

Garnish with chopped fresh parsley if desired, then slice and serve warm. Enjoy your rich, flavorful Easy Parmesan Garlic Bacon Cheeseburger Lasagna!

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I Use Different Types of Noodles?

Absolutely! You can use whole wheat or gluten-free lasagna noodles as alternatives. Just make sure to follow the cooking instructions for those specific noodles to achieve the best texture.

How Can I Make This Recipe Vegetarian?

For a vegetarian version, simply substitute the ground beef with a plant-based meat substitute like lentils, mushrooms, or a store-bought meat alternative. You can also add vegetables like spinach or bell peppers for extra flavor and nutrition!

Can I Prepare This Lasagna in Advance?

Yes! You can assemble the lasagna a day ahead and store it in the refrigerator before baking. Just cover it tightly with foil or plastic wrap. When you’re ready to cook it, you may need to add an extra 5-10 minutes to the baking time since it will be cold from the fridge.

What’s the Best Way to Store Leftovers?

Store any leftover lasagna in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3-4 days. To reheat, microwave individual portions or warm it in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until heated through. Enjoy this tasty dish again!
